Output ecddccf32d1f7883b99792978b54f94707e53bb6ee7847a5a80109d12bb06763:2

value
42823610
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77bbe3382b87997d7ee80abfe9c2914ee6ace7eb OP_EQUAL
address
MJpFiv4U8PViYSNrWmu17enjvp9K4ZjWGz
transaction
ecddccf32d1f7883b99792978b54f94707e53bb6ee7847a5a80109d12bb06763
spent
true